A Long-Lasting Solution to Stay Hair-FreeYou can find there are many types of epilators. The first epilators to hit the market were the spring type. As the name suggests, they have rotating coil springs. This motion catches hairs in the spring, and pulls yanks them from the root.

Similar to spring epilators, another type is the rotating disc epilators. They use a rotating motion to catch and pull hair, but utilize ceramic discs instead of spring coils. The tweezers kind of epilators is yet another type that uses multiple mechanical tweezers to pull out the hair.

Everything you need to know about epilators

If you want to prevent ingrown hair, exfoliation is extremely important. Exfoliate before each epilation session to remove dead skin cells, and after that every 2-3 days. You’ll feel great after using the epilator for its ease of use and the astonishing results.

Always hold an epilator at a 90 degrees angle to the skin. It’s the most appropriate and comfortable way of holding it, unless you have found a unique position that suits you best. Don’t press it against the skin; hold it loose because the rotatory tweezers will grab on the hairs, and pull them by the root.

Hold your skin taut to ease the pain, and it’s key to use the epilator efficiently. When epilating your underarms, raise your hands over your head, and stretch them as much as you can. Move the epilator slowly against the direction of the hair growth without rushing. Otherwise, the hair will break at the skin’s surface, instead of being pulled from its root.

The shorter the hair, the lesser the pain! That’s why it’s best to epilate once every two weeks. Some women have a higher pain threshold than others, so it depends on how well you can tolerate pain.  It’s best to epilate at night since your skin can redden from a side effect. Use a moisturizer after epilation to soothe the skin. Your skin should be perfect, and return to its natural color minus the hairs when you wake up in the morning.

Clean your epilator thoroughly with a cleaning brush, and wash the tweezers’ head. Even if the head is not washable, if you let it dry long enough, it’s safe to use the next time you plug it in.
